The GPU Specifications

Turing TU116 GPU Specifications

The GPU TU116 for the GeForce GTX 1660 and 1660 Ti contains 6.6 billion transistors localized on the die. In comparison, Pascal had close to 12 billion transistors on a die size of 471mm2. Gamers will immediately look at the shader processors; the Quadro RTX 8000 has 4608 of them enabled and since everything with bits is in multitudes of eight and while looking at the GPU die photos; it has 24 SMs (streaming multiprocessors) each holding 64 cores = 1536 Shader processors. This GPU is fabbed on an optimized 12nm TSMC FinFET+ node and the full GPU is unlocked. Since the GeForce GTX 1660 is using the same chip as the Ti and has 1408 Shader processors we can quickly conclude that 1408/64 the unit has 22 shader clusters. Each shader cluster has four Texture units, so that makes up for 88 of them.

Next, to a slightly reconfigured shader count, the secondary change for the GTX 1660 is its memory. NVIDIA fits this card series with cheaper GDDR5 memory, which will offer less bandwidth, 192 Gb/sec over 288 GB/s for the Ti model. That difference is substantial and will make the card perform quite a bit slower than the Ti version. Of course, you can always try to tweak the memory bandwidth, which we'll show you in our tweaking segment of this article.
